Description
This unusual machine resembles an early Edison concert cylinder phonograph. Upper works and bedplate appear to be fabricated out of steel plate -not the usual castings. Brass carriage and mandrel. Early Edison-style automatic reproducer with some variance in modifications. Good stylus. Motor appears complete and as with the upper mechanism, the motor castings also appear to be fabricated. Cabinet and cover appear to be hand-built. Overall good condition with original golden oak finish. Small accessory drawer. Missing winding crank. This machine appears to either be a prototype or patent model?? Nicely built by someone with very advanced skills. A welcome addition to any collection. Base measures approximately 12 3/4" X 18" and with lid, approx. 18"H
